Who Can Be Tested?

Normally anyone can be tested. However, the manufacturer recommends not subjecting the following persons to a measurement:

  • pregnant women
  • patients with pacemakers
  • patients with severe cardiac dysrythmia
  • children under age 10

How Is It Done?

The patient removes his socks and places his feet on the designated electrode fields of the equipment table. Then he is given one electrode to hold in each of his hands and, finally, a headband with the electrodes for the left and right side of the forehead is placed on his head. The therapist starts the machine and the whole process only takes about 10 minutes.
